Q: Is 857,983 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 857,983 is not a prime number.

Why is 857,983 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 857983 can be evenly divided by 1 7 19 133 6,451 45,157 122,569 and 857,983, with no remainder.

Since 857,983 cannot be divided by just 1 and 857,983, it is not a prime number.
